the PFC will be fine for the mods you have and mods you plan on adding. but to run higher boost you should upgrade the fuel system (bigger injectors, better fuel pump). and also port the wastegate so you don't get boost creep. especially if you're gonna go with a midpipe or a high-flow cat.
